Exploring speaker similarity based selection of relevant populations for forensic automatic speaker recognition

Linda Gerlach, Finnian Kelly, Kirsty McDougall, Anil Alexander

This study investigates various strategies for selecting relevant populations and their impact on forensic automatic speaker recognition in a likelihood ratio framework. Besides random and demographic metadata-based selection, it explores perceptual voice similarity as a potential criterion. Using a database controlled for gender, language, and recording conditions, an automatic approach based on phonetic features was used to select the most and least perceptually similar speakers to questioned speaker recordings in mock cases. It compares the strength of evidence obtained using these strategies for male and female mock cases and across different relevant population sizes. Random and metadata-based selections converge in log-likelihood ratio cost (Cllr) as the selected population size nears 50. While using perceptually similar speakers improves the overall Cllr, in individual cases effects may vary based on the degree of perceptual similarity or dissimilarity between recordings.
